Resources: Recycling as a sustainable source of raw materials

June 22, 2012

Many raw materials for industrial applications, such as certain metals and rare earth elements, are growing scarcer or more expensive. Efficient recycling methods could provide a solution.

Image: DW

A research center in Saxony is exploring new recycling technologies. The researchers have developed a machine to separate the components of devices like laptops and mobile phones, and a chemical method for isolating lithium from old storage batteries. Their latest project involves collecting dust from the street to see if the platinum, copper and zinc it contains can be recovered.
